Research On Resource Allocation Algorithm In D2D Communication System

As one of the key technologies of the 5G network,the D2D(Device-to-Device)communication technology allows adjacent users in the cellular network to communicate with each other directly,which can effectively reduce the load of the base station and improve the performance of the wireless network.D2 D users reuse Licensed Spectrum in cellular networks to communicate with others,thus it could improve the spectral efficiency.Therefore,introducing D2 D communication technology can improve the performance of the wireless network effectively.However,there is much interference between users caused by spectrum multiplexing in the D2 D communication network,it is necessary to design an efficient resource allocation algorithm to solve the problem.In the thesis,the scenario of D2 D users sharing spectrum resource with cellular user is mainly considered.And mainly solved the problem of resource allocation in the D2 D communication network.Firstly,analyze and investigate the D2 D communication networks,its network architecture,working mode and application scenarios,carry out the research about the application of matching theory in wireless resource allocation and pave the way for designing a resource allocation algorithm for D2 D networks.Secondly,considering the scenario that a single D2 D user shares spectrum resource with a single cellular user,so design a resource allocation algorithm based on "one-to-one" matching theory for the interference between D2 D users and cellular users which multiplex spectrum resources in the network.That could reduce the interference between D2 D users and cellular users and improving the network performance.Finally,study and analyze the resource allocation problem in the scenario that multiple D2 D users sharing spectrum scenarios with a single cellular user.It not only considers the interference between cellular users and D2 D users,but also considers the interference between different D2 D users which use the same frequency band.The resource allocation algorithm based on the one-to-many matching theory is proposed to implement interference management among users efficiently,and it may optimize the resource allocation in the D2 D communication system.Through the research of D2 D communication system,the resource allocation algorithms based on matching theory for the resource allocation problem are proposed,the scenarios of which are about a single D2 D user pair sharing thespectrum resource with a single cellular user and multiple D2 D user pairs sharing the spectrum resource with a single cellular use.The investigation will optimize the performance of the D2 D communication network in a great degree.
